Vers un modèle de support de l'interopérabilité des fédérations de composants logiciels
Thèses / mémoires Ecrit par: Khaled, Sellami ; Ahmed Nacer, Mohamed ; Publié en: 2005
Résumé: La construction de logiciels à partir de l’assemblage d’éléments existants de haut niveau constitue le rêve des informaticiens depuis plus de 20 ans, c’est dans ce contexte que se situe notre travail.Dans cette thèse nous avons commencé par étudier les environnements de génie logiciel centrés procédés afin d’identifier les différents problèmes d’intégration d’outils logiciels existants. Nous avons ensuite analysé l’approche par composants. Nous avons identifié les différents modèles à composants, ainsi que leurs caractéristiques, et les différentes approches permettant l’assemblage de ces composants (CBSE, EAI, BDD fédérées, outils de workflows fédérés, fédérations d’outils logiciels,..). Nous nous somme directement intéressés dans cette thèse au problème d’assemblage de fédérations d’outils dans lequel un groupe de fédérations d’outils logiciels sont amenées à travailler et à coopérer ensemble, nous utilisons le concept de ‘’ fédération’’ comme une architecture logicielle qui matérialise cet assemblage, nous définissons trois fondations (fondation de l’application, fondation de contrôle, fondation du procédé) comme structure de base de la méta-fédération et cela comme solution aux problèmes de recouvrements des concepts des fédérations d’outils, d’indéterminisme de celles-ci, et de leurs adaptations.
Béjaïa:
Langue:
Français
Collation:
77 p. ill.
;30 cm
Diplôme:
Magister
Etablissement de soutenance:
Béjaïa, Université Abderahmane Mira de Béjaïa. Faculté des Sciences et des Sciences de l'Ingénieur
Spécialité:
Informatique
Index décimal
004.6 .Communications, interfaçage (coopération en matière de réseaux informatiques, équipement et techniques reliant les ordinateurs aux appareils périphériques ou à d'autres ordinateurs, hardware d'interfaçage et de transmission des données ; ouvrages généraux
Thème
Informatique
Mots clés:
Composants logiciels
Interfaçages et communications (informatique)
Note: Bibliogr.pp.[78-85]; Annexe pp.[86-98]